Released on September 1, 2003, under the esteemed Naxos label, this album offers a compelling journey through Bridge's early 20th-century musical landscape.
The album presents a total of seven movements, divided into two quartets, each with its own distinct character and emotional depth. The first quartet opens with a dramatic "Adagio - Allegro appassionato," followed by a tender "Adagio molto," and concludes with a lively "Allegretto grazioso - Animato." The third quartet begins with a contemplative "Andante moderato - Allegro moderato," transitions into a flowing "Andante con moto," and culminates in an energetic "Allegro energico."
